Step 1
Product Context
Synapse's Global Cash Management product is likely a financial service offering that helps businesses manage their cash flows across multiple countries and currencies. It probably includes features like multi-currency accounts, international payments, foreign exchange services, and cash flow forecasting tools.
Key stakeholders include:
- Corporate clients (primary users)
- Synapse's leadership and shareholders
- Regulatory bodies in various jurisdictions
- Partner banks and financial institutions
The user flow might involve:
- Account setup and integration with existing systems
- Initiating and receiving international payments
- Currency conversion and management
- Generating reports and forecasts
This product fits into Synapse's broader strategy of providing comprehensive financial solutions for global businesses, likely competing with traditional banks and fintech companies like TransferWise (now Wise) or Revolut.
In terms of product lifecycle, Global Cash Management is probably in the growth stage, with Synapse focusing on expanding its client base and feature set.
